Essentials of a Quality Management System for Medical Devices

Essentials of a Quality Management System for Medical Devices

A robust Quality Management System for medical devices is vital to ensure product safety and effectiveness. Key essentials include rigorous document control to manage procedures, specifications, and records. Risk management is crucial in identifying and mitigating potential issues. Compliance with industry standards and regulatory requirements, such as ISO 13485 and FDA QMS System regulations, is paramount. Effective design and development processes, rigorous testing, and validation procedures are essential to produce safe, reliable devices. Post-market surveillance and continuous improvement are also integral, helping to monitor and enhance product performance, address customer feedback, and adapt to evolving regulatory demands. Employee training and adherence to best practices round out a comprehensive medical qms system.

Best Practices for Successful Implementation of Quality Management Software for Medical Devices

Best Practices for Successful Implementation of Quality Management Software for Medical Devices

Implementing Quality Management Software (QMS) for medical devices is critical in ensuring compliance with industry standards and regulations, such as ISO 13485 and FDA requirements. A robust QMS not only helps maintain high-quality standards but also enhances overall operational efficiency. Here are some best practices for successfully implementing quality management software for medical devices.

Implementation of Quality Management Software for Medical Devices

Understanding the Regulatory Requirements

  • ISO 13485 Compliance: ISO 13485 is a globally recognized standard for quality management system in medical devices industry. Ensuring that your QMS software is ISO 13485 compliant is crucial. This standard sets the framework for quality management processes and helps meet regulatory requirements.
  • FDA Regulations: The FDA has stringent requirements for medical devices. Implementing a QMS that aligns with FDA regulations ensures that your products meet safety and efficacy standards. A QMS FDA medical device compliance, is essential for market approval and patient safety.

Choosing the Right QMS Software

  • Evaluate Your Needs: Before selecting a QMS software for medical devices, assess your organization’s specific needs. Consider factors such as the size of your company, the complexity of your operations, and the regulatory requirements you need to meet.
  • Features to Look For: Ensure that the medical device QMS software includes document control, risk management, corrective and preventive actions (CAPA), audit management, and training management. The best QMS software for medical devices should integrate seamlessly with your existing systems and processes.

Integration with Existing Systems

  • Seamless Integration: Your QMS software should integrate smoothly with other systems like ERP, CRM, and manufacturing execution systems (MES). This integration ensures data flows seamlessly across different departments, improving overall efficiency and compliance.
  • Data Migration: When transitioning to a new quality management system medical device, ensure that all critical data is accurately migrated. This includes historical quality records, supplier information, and compliance documentation.

Training and Support

  • Comprehensive Training: Invest in comprehensive training programs for your staff. A well-trained team is essential for successfully implementing and using medical device quality management system software. Training should cover all aspects of the software, including user interface, key functionalities, and troubleshooting.
  • Ongoing Support: Choose a QMS provider that offers robust customer support. This support should include technical assistance, software updates, and access to best practice resources. Ongoing support ensures that your QMS remains effective and up-to-date with regulatory changes

Customization and Scalability

  • Customization: Every medical device company has unique needs. Ensure your medical device QMS software can be customized to meet your specific requirements. Customization might include tailored workflows, specific reporting capabilities, and unique compliance features.
  • Scalability: As your company grows, your QMS software should scale with you. The best QMS software for medical devices should accommodate increased data volume, additional users, and expanded functionalities without compromising performance.

Ensuring Data Integrity and Security

  • Data Integrity: Maintaining data integrity is critical in the medical device industry. Your QMS software should have robust mechanisms to ensure data accuracy, consistency, and reliability. This includes audit trails, electronic signatures, and data validation processes.
  • Security Measures: Implementing strong security measures is vital to protect sensitive information. Ensure that your medical device quality management system software complies with industry standards for data security, including encryption, access controls, and regular security audits.

Continuous Improvement

  • Regular Audits and Reviews: Conduct regular audits and reviews of your QMS to identify areas for improvement. This proactive approach helps maintain compliance and enhance the overall quality of your processes and products.
  • Feedback Loop: Establish a feedback loop to gather input from users of the QMS. This feedback can provide valuable insights into the system’s performance and areas for improvement. Continuous improvement is key to maintaining an effective Quality Management System for Medical Devices.

Partnering with a Reliable Vendor

  • Vendor Reputation: Choose a vendor with a proven track record in providing iso 13485 quality management software for medical devices. Look for testimonials, case studies, and industry recognition to ensure the vendor is reputable and experienced.
  • Ongoing Partnership: Establish an ongoing partnership with your QMS vendor. This partnership ensures you receive continuous support, updates, and improvements to your QMS software, keeping it aligned with industry best practices and regulatory changes.

Frequently Asked Questions

  • To meet FDA and EU MDR requirements, medical device companies must implement a QMS that includes core functionalities such as:

    • Document control

    • Audit and CAPA management

    • Complaint and nonconformance handling

    • Change and training management

    • Supplier and equipment oversight

    Compliance with 21 CFR Part 820 (FDA) and ISO 13485/EU MDR standards demands end-to-end traceability, proactive risk management, and continuous improvement across all quality processes.

  • The current ISO 13485 standard emphasizes integrating internal processes to minimize risk within the organization. This integration includes:

    • Product planning

    • Corrective Actions and Preventive Actions (CAPA)

    • Verification, validation, and revalidation

    • Monitoring, testing, and traceability

    • Risk management documentation in product realization

    Another major change in the current version of ISO 13485 is regarding outsourcing. According to the new version of the ISO 13485 standard, companies that are contracted for the development, design, or servicing of medical devices must also meet ISO 13485 standards.
